Abstract(in English) | We consider an Integrate-and Fire neuron Model (ab. IFM) with two periodic inputs. The IFM outputs various firing pulse-trains including chaotic ones. The pulse-train can be analyzed by one dimensional return map. The first input determines the basic figure of the return map. The second input is high frequency periodic impulse sequence that is synchronized with the first one. Applying the second input, the state of the return map is quantized and the IFM outputs various stable periodic pulse-trains. The quantized return map can be transformed into an integer map. The integer map can be analyzed precisely and speedily. First, we analyze the case of a constant second input. Next, we apply the second input and analyze the numbers of the periodic pulse-trains and their maximum periods. |
